# Build Provenance: Sheetpress Export Memory Fix

Quick context for the security review: the memory spike in large spreadsheet exports came from buffering whole workbooks in RAM. The fix streams rows instead, so peak usage is now flat regardless of sheet size. The streaming patch was built in our hermetic pipeline — no vendored deps changed. Everything's reproducible from the tag. The attested build identifier follows below.

build token for yajof-bajof: htk31_506ff1188f74596b5bb2eec94edc43c

Welcome to Hollowpine Labs! When you arrive, check in at the front desk in the Crestway Building — Dalia or Ren will get you sorted with a lanyard and a quick safety rundown. Contractors can move freely on floors two and three. To get through the workshop door, enter the code below.

staff pass of kawip-hawef = bdg-QLP-2

# Break-Glass: Catalog Cache Invalidation

Scope: the Pinrow product catalog at Veldstone Retail. If stale prices persist after a purge and the Hollowmere invalidation queue is wedged, use break-glass to flush the edge tier directly. Contractors: get verbal sign-off from the catalog lead first. Steps: open the Hollowmere admin shell, select emergency-flush, confirm the tenant, and run it once — repeated flushes thrash the origin. Access is logged and expires after 20 minutes. Unseal the admin shell with the passphrase below.

recovery phrase for kahop-tajog: istix-casvan